How much do full time unity game developer jobs pay per year?
As of Aug 15, 2026, the average yearly pay for full time unity game developer in Phoenix, AZ is $107,702.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$80,900.00 and $123,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.
Full Time Unity Game Developers often encounter challenges such as optimizing game performance for multiple platforms, managing complex codebases, and ensuring effective collaboration with artists, designers, and QA testers. On large-scale projects, maintaining clear communication and version control is crucial, as multiple team members may be working on different features simultaneously. Adapting to evolving project requirements and integrating feedback from playtesting are also essential skills that help ensure a polished final product.
Full time Unity game developer jobs are in demand due to the growth of the gaming industry and increasing use of Unity for mobile, PC, and console game development. Employers seek developers skilled in C# and familiar with Unity's tools, with job opportunities often available across various regions and platforms.
A Full Time Unity Game Developer designs, develops, and maintains interactive games or applications using the Unity engine. They write code in languages like C#, create and integrate game assets, and collaborate with artists, designers, and other developers to bring game concepts to life. Their responsibilities include optimizing performance, troubleshooting bugs, and ensuring a smooth user experience across multiple platforms. Unity developers often work in teams and may specialize in areas such as gameplay programming, UI, or graphics. Staying current with the latest Unity updates and industry trends is also an important part of the role.
To thrive as a Full Time Unity Game Developer, you need strong proficiency in C# programming, game design principles, and a solid understanding of the Unity engine, often supported by a relevant degree or portfolio of completed projects. Familiarity with Unity’s scripting APIs, version control systems like Git, and experience with 2D/3D asset integration are typically essential. Creativity, problem-solving, and effective teamwork are standout soft skills for this role. These skills and qualities are crucial for building engaging, optimized games and collaborating efficiently within multidisciplinary development teams.
